Dimitri Leslie Roger (born July 13, 1992), known as Rich the Kid, is an American rapper. He started by releasing his own mixtapes. In 2017, he signed with Interscope Records. He then released his first studio album, The World Is Yours (2018). This album included popular songs like "New Freezer" (with Kendrick Lamar) and "Plug Walk". It reached number two on the Billboard 200 music chart.

His next albums, The World Is Yours 2 (2019) and Boss Man (2020), also did well on the charts. He has also made music with other artists. These include Nobody Safe (2020) with YoungBoy Never Broke Again and Trust Fund Babies (2021) with Lil Wayne. In 2016, he started his own record label called Rich Forever Music. Through this label, he has signed rappers like Famous Dex and Jay Critch.

In 2024, his song "Carnival" (with ¥$ and Playboi Carti) became very popular. It reached the top of the Billboard Hot 100 chart. This was his first song to achieve this. Kanye West and Ty Dolla Sign helped produce his fourth studio album, Life's a Gamble (2024).

Early Life and Music Beginnings

Dimitri Leslie Roger was born in Queens, New York City, on July 13, 1992. His family is from Haiti, and he grew up speaking Haitian Creole. When he was 13, his parents divorced. He then moved with his mother to College Park, Georgia.

When he was young, Rich the Kid listened to famous rappers like Nas, Jay-Z, 2Pac, the Notorious B.I.G., and 50 Cent. After moving to College Park, he started listening to Southern hip hop artists such as T.I. and Jeezy. His first rap name was Black Boy Da Kid. He later changed it to Rich the Kid. He went to Elmont Memorial Junior – Senior High School in Elmont, New York.

Music Career Journey

2013–2016: Starting Out and Early Mixtapes

In 2013, Rich the Kid released his first solo mixtape, Been About the Benjamins. Later that year, he worked with the group Migos on a mixtape series called Streets On Lock. They released several volumes of this series over the next few years. His second solo mixtape, Feels Good 2 Be Rich, came out in August 2014. It featured many artists like Migos, Young Thug, and Soulja Boy.

In November 2014, he released the song "On My Way" with Bobby Shmurda and Rowdy Rebel. In December 2014, his third mixtape Rich Than Famous was released. It included songs with YG, Migos, and Gucci Mane.

In 2015, Rich the Kid continued to release music. He put out Still On Lock with Migos. In August 2015, he released Flexin' on Purpose, which had 14 songs. This project featured collaborations with Master P, Young Dolph, and Ty Dolla $ign. In October 2015, he released Streets On Lock 4 with Migos.

On Thanksgiving Day, November 26, 2015, Rich the Kid and iLoveMakonnen released Whip It. This mixtape had 8 songs. The next month, Dabbin Fever came out on Christmas Eve 2015. It featured artists like Wiz Khalifa, Migos, and 21 Savage. In April 2016, he released his Trap Talk mixtape. This project included songs with 21 Savage, Ty Dolla $ign, and Playboi Carti.

In March 2016, Rich the Kid started his own record label, Rich Forever Music. In October 2016, he released his mixtape Keep Flexin. It featured artists such as Desiigner, Migos, and Jeremih.

2017–2018: Becoming More Famous and The World Is Yours

In May 2017, Rich the Kid was featured on the Diplo song "Bankroll". This song also included Rich Brian and Young Thug.

On June 9, 2017, Rich the Kid announced he had signed with Interscope Records. He explained that Interscope understood his goals for himself and his label. He felt they gave him a great chance to succeed in the music industry.

Rich the Kid released the song "New Freezer" with Kendrick Lamar on September 26, 2017. This song was his first to appear on the Billboard Hot 100 chart, reaching number 41. On February 9, 2018, he released "Plug Walk". This song became his highest-charting single at the time, reaching number 13 on the Hot 100. A remix of "Plug Walk" was released later, featuring Gucci Mane, YG, and 2 Chainz.

These songs were part of Rich the Kid's first studio album, The World Is Yours. The album featured many guest artists, including Lil Wayne, Swae Lee, Quavo, and Chris Brown. It debuted at number two on the US Billboard 200 chart.

2019-2021: More Albums and Collaborations

On January 9, 2019, Rich the Kid released the music video for his song "Splashin". On March 1, 2019, he released "4 Phones" and announced his second studio album, The World Is Yours 2. The album's third song, "Tic Toc" with Tory Lanez, came out on March 14, 2019. The World Is Yours 2 featured artists like Big Sean, YoungBoy Never Broke Again, and Lil Pump. This album debuted at number 4 on the Billboard 200 US albums chart.

On December 6, 2019, it was announced that Rich the Kid had left Interscope Records and signed with Republic Records. He released the song "That's Tuff" featuring Quavo as the first song from his next album. The second song, "Money Talk" with YoungBoy Never Broke Again, was released on January 17, 2020. His third studio album, Boss Man, was released on March 13, 2020. It featured guest appearances from Lil Baby, DaBaby, Nicki Minaj, and Post Malone.

In February 2020, Rich the Kid signed a deal with Empire Distribution. On October 16, 2020, he teamed up with NBA YoungBoy for the song "Bankroll". Their collaborative mixtape, Nobody Safe, was released on November 20, 2020.

On April 14, 2021, Rich the Kid signed a multi-million dollar deal with Rostrum Records. He then released "Feelin' Like Tunechi" with Lil Wayne on October 1, 2021. Their collaborative mixtape, Trust Fund Babies, was released on the same day.

2022–Present: Rich Forever Returns and Life's A Gamble

On November 14, 2022, Rich the Kid signed with RCA Records and released the song "Motion".

In mid-2023, he started working on Rich Forever 5. He announced that he, Famous Dex, and Jay Critch were working together again. They released their collaborative song "Big Dawg" in December 2023. The trio then released "Rich & Reckless" in January 2024. Rich also announced that his fourth studio album would be called Life's A Gamble.

On February 10, 2024, Rich the Kid was a guest performer on the song "Carnival" by Kanye West and Ty Dolla Sign. This song became his first to reach the top of the Billboard Hot 100 chart. Following this success, on June 22, 2024, he released "Gimme a Second 2". This song is a collaboration with West, featuring Ty Dolla Sign and Peso Pluma. It is the main song from his album, Life's a Gamble, which was released in July 2024.

In March 2016, Rich the Kid started his own record label called Rich Forever Music. The first artist to sign with the label was Famous Dex from Chicago. He also signed his first producer, The Lab Cook. In April 2016, Rich the Kid signed his second artist, rapper J $tash.

The record label's first release was a 15-song collection called Rich Forever Music. It featured artists like Offset, Skippa Da Flippa, and Lil Yachty. After this release, J $tash left the label.

In June 2016, Rich the Kid made a deal for 300 Entertainment to become a partner company for Rich Forever Music.

On July 4, 2016, Rich Forever Music released their second project, Rich Forever 2. This was a collaborative mixtape between Rich the Kid and Famous Dex. It included appearances from Wiz Khalifa, Lil Yachty, and Young Thug. In November 2016, Rich the Kid signed Brooklyn rapper Jay Critch to his label.

On March 17, 2017, the label released their third collection mixtape, The Rich Forever Way. The label released their fourth collection, Rich Forever 3, on June 16, 2017.

In February 2018, Rich the Kid signed Texas rapper Almighty Jay to his label. However, in March 2018, YBN Almighty Jay and Rich the Kid had a disagreement. Rich the Kid released a song called Back Quick without YBN Almighty Jay's permission. In April 2018, YBN Almighty Jay stated in an interview that he was never officially signed with the label.

In May 2018, Famous Dex said he had left Rich Forever Music and was working as an independent artist. However, Rich the Kid later stated on the label's Instagram page that Famous Dex was still signed with them.
